Understanding the Mechanics of Midpoint Trees
The foundation of midpoint tree analysis lies in understanding how planetary midpoints create intricate webs of connection throughout a birth chart. A midpoint represents the exact halfway point between any two planets, calculated by finding the shortest distance between them along the zodiacal circle. When multiple midpoints align within a tight orb, they form what astrologers call a midpoint tree.
These mathematical relationships create powerful resonance points in the chart that operate like cosmic amplifiers. Think of them as nodes where multiple streams of planetary energy converge and interact, creating a concentrated force field of influence.
The activation of a midpoint tree by transit or progression often correlates with significant life developments that seem to affect multiple areas simultaneously. This is because each branch of the tree connects to different planetary combinations, each carrying its own symbolic meaning.
The precision required in midpoint tree analysis makes it particularly valuable for timing predictions. When a transiting planet crosses a midpoint tree, it typically triggers events or psychological processes related to all the planets involved in that tree structure.
Professional astrologers often use specialized software to identify and track midpoint trees, as the calculations can become quite complex when dealing with multiple planetary combinations. The most powerful trees typically involve personal points like the Ascendant or Midheaven, along with significant planetary configurations.

Can midpoint trees change over time?
While the natal midpoint tree structure remains constant, its activation points shift through progressions and solar arc directions. Additionally, new temporary midpoint trees can form through transit patterns, creating periods of heightened sensitivity and potential manifestation.
How many planets typically form a significant midpoint tree?
A meaningful midpoint tree usually involves at least three planetary pairs creating midpoints within a 1-2 degree orb. However, the most powerful configurations often include four or more planetary combinations, especially when personal points like the Ascendant or Midheaven are involved.
What software is best for calculating midpoint trees?
Professional astrological software like Sirius, Solar Fire, or Jigsaw offer comprehensive midpoint tree calculation features. These programs can identify complex midpoint patterns and track their activations through various timing techniques, making them essential tools for serious practitioners.
